All hunters must now obtain a hunting license in order to kill a whale. Although pilot whale meat and blubber contains much protein, iron, carnitine and vitamins, there are concerns that the high levels of mercury and PCBs in the whales can have detrimental health effects. Still, the Faroese continue to kill and consume hundreds of whales each year.

Animals are surrounded as they migrate past the shores of the Danish territory and herded toward the beach, where they are hacked to death.
